Researchers reveal how immune system distinguishes between beneficial and pathogenic organisms

The human gut is filled with 100 trillion symbiotic bacteria-ten times more microbial cells than our own cells-representing close to one thousand different species. "And yet, if you were to eat a piece of chicken with just a few Salmonella, your immune system would mount a potent inflammatory response," says Sarkis K. Mazmanian, assistant professor of biology at the California Institute of Technology (Caltech).

Gamma Knife surgery stops growth of 'World's tallest living human'

Sultan Kosen won't be posting new world records for height anymore, but that's just fine with him. The Gamma Knife radiosurgery the 29-year-old Turkish man had in August 2010 has successfully stopped his growth at the height of 8 ft 3 in (251 cm). Mr. Kosen, who suffered the effects of acromegaly, has held the title of "World's Tallest Living Human" since September 2009, when his 8 ft plus stature edged 7 ft 9 in Xiu Xung from China.

Optometrists: Doctors of optometry (ODs) are the primary health care professionals for the eye. Optometrists examine, diagnose, treat, and manage diseases, injuries, and disorders of the visual system, the eye, and associated structures as well as identify related systemic conditions affecting the eye. An optometrist has completed pre-professional undergraduate education in a college or university and four years of professional education at a college of optometry, leading to the doctor of optometry (O.D.) degree. Some optometrists complete an optional residency in a specific area of practice. Optometrists are eye health care professionals state-licensed to diagnose and treat diseases and disorders of the eye and visual system.
